SQL Server 2008关键知识点详解####一、SQL Server 2008概述- 版本发布与版权信息:本书由微软出版社出版,版权所有为微软公司,出版时间为2008年。该书受到版权保护,未经允许不得复制或传播。 - 内容定位:这是一本关于SQL Server 2008的专业开发书籍,帮助读者深入理解SQL Server 2008的核心概念和技术特性。 ####二、SQL Server 2008的主要功能与特点- 数据库管理:SQL Server 2008提供了强大的数据存储和管理能力,支持多种数据类型,包括XML数据类型。 - 安全性增强:通过改进的身份验证机制、加密支持以及更精细的权限控制,提升了系统的安全性。 - 可扩展性与性能优化:SQL Server 2008支持更大的数据集处理,同时提供了更多的索引选项以提高查询效率。 - 报表服务:集成的报表服务功能使得创建、管理和分发报表变得更加简单快捷。 - 业务智能工具:提供了丰富的工具集用于数据分析、挖掘和预测。 - 多语言支持:支持多种语言环境,便于全球范围内的部署与使用。 ####三、SQL Server 2008的安装与配置- 系统要求:安装前需确认操作系统版本、内存大小、磁盘空间等是否满足最低要求。 - 安装过程:遵循向导步骤完成安装,包括选择组件、设置服务账户、配置实例名称等。 - 配置管理器:利用SQL Server Configuration Manager进行网络协议、服务启动模式等高级配置。 ####四、SQL Server 2008数据库设计与管理- 数据库架构:包括表、视图、存储过程等数据库对象的设计原则与最佳实践。 - 数据完整性与约束:确保数据准确性和一致性的方法,如主键、外键、检查约束等。 - 事务处理:了解事务的基本概念,掌握如何使用事务来保证数据操作的一致性和隔离性。 - 备份与恢复策略:制定合理的备份计划,并学会在不同场景下进行数据库的恢复操作。 ####五、SQL Server 2008性能调优与监控- 性能监控工具:使用SQL Server Profiler、动态管理视图等工具来监控服务器性能。 - 索引优化:合理设计和